*Bomber Packs

Bomber Pack seed balls are made with the same quality materials, but with a slightly different process to bring the price down. These average a slightly higher number of seeds/ball than our regular seed balls, but the number of seeds per ball is somewhat variable. They are made-to-order, so add 3 days to handling time.

Texas Bluebonnets

Lupinus texensis
One of the many bluebonnets of Texas, this one is the easiest to grow, and is - reportedly - THE Texas Bluebonnet. I'm not from Texas, so if you are and know the lore, you could email me and I can share. 

This particular one is among the easiest to grow, reaches 18"-24" and has bold blue spikes tipped in white. It is a hardy annual and loves full sun. It requires well draining soils. In heavy soil, it will germinate, but not establish. Its root systems work in tandem with Rhizobium to fix nitrogen and improve soil fertility. 

The best time to plant these beauties is September. They grow all winter and bloom in early spring. Unfortunately, you won't have much luck if you're where it gets cold.
